Side-by-side financial comparison of Energy Services of America CORP (ESOA) and INDEPENDENCE REALTY TRUST, INC. (IRT). Click either name above to swap in a different company.

INDEPENDENCE REALTY TRUST, INC. is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($165.3M vs $114.1M, roughly 1.4× Energy Services of America CORP). On growth, Energy Services of America CORP posted the faster year-over-year revenue change (13.4% vs 2.5%). Over the past eight quarters, Energy Services of America CORP's revenue compounded faster (26.7% CAGR vs 2.2%).
